An electrophile is a molecule that seeks electrons, making it a Lewis acid in a Lewis acid-base reaction. It accepts a pair of electrons from a nucleophile, which is the Lewis base, to form a new chemical bond. This interaction helps drive the reaction forward.

In a Lewis acid-base reaction, a Lewis acid (electron pair acceptor) reacts with a Lewis base (electron pair donor) to form a coordination complex. The Lewis acid accepts electron pairs from the Lewis base, resulting in the formation of a coordinate covalent bond between the two species.
The Lewis base donates one or more pairs of electrons to the Lewis acid in order to form a compound with one or more dative bonds.
